How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Duquesne?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Duquesne Studio Apartments | $690 | $690 | $690 |
Duquesne 1 Bedroom Apartments | $799 | $710 | $1,000 |
Duquesne 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,021 | $845 | $1,213 |
Duquesne 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,245 | $1,005 | $1,525 |

Cheapest Available Duquesne 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 06,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Duquesne, PA is the One Bedroom Model starting from $710 at Della Plaza in the East Allegheny neighborhood. The second most affordable Duquesne 1 Bedroom is the 1BR/1.0BA Model at WestWood Apartments starting at $725 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Duquesne is currently $799.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Duquesne: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Della Plaza | One Bedroom | $710 |
WestWood Apartments | 1BR/1.0BA | $725 |
Brinton Manor | 1 Bedroom Market | $1,000 |
